The PCBA's Annual 2-day MCLE Conference is will be held at Timbercreek Ballroom, Roseville. 

As with previous years, you will have the option of receiving material in the form of a book, or you can download an electronic version approximately a week prior to the conference. Please choose either to receive a pdf or the booklet.  Due to the increased costs of printing, hardbound book cost will be $40.00.  When registering, please be sure to select your breakout session choices.  Your decision helps us to ensure the appropriate size room and comfort for the number of attending each session. 

Also when registering, you will have the option of any dietary needs, such as gluten-free, dairy-free and vegetarian.  A breakfast buffet of fruit, eggs, bacon, potatoes and breakfast breads will be available on both Friday and Saturday so be sure to get there early, register and enjoy some breakfast and networking with colleagues before a day of education.  Lunch will be provided on both days, so be sure to check the box if you plan to attend lunch. Instead of eating and listening to a presentation at lunch, Friday lunch will provide time to eat and network with your colleagues.

See the below schedule.  Learn how to recover and safe forensic information from cellphones (Don Vilfer), new laws if you are an employer or employee (Katie Collins), and Ethics and Civility Intersection: Two Sides of the Same Coin with retired Judge Barbara Kronlund.  Friday afternoon will have breakout sessions - Forensic CPA in the Litigation Process (Craig Connerty, CPA), Don't Get Slapped - Anti-Slapp Actions in Family Law Cases (Brendon Begley), Human Trafficking (Jason Collins) and Prop 19 and Estate Planning (Tasha Jahn).  Before the afternoon ends and Happy Hour begins, Associate Justice Shama Mesiwala will present Ladies Justice for Implicit Bias credit.

Our three plenary sessions on Saturday include Jury Selection, CCP 231.7 and Practice Tips (Danny Jensen), Winning with Empathy and Mindfulness (Carol Bauss-competency credit/wellness) and AI and Legal Ethics:  AI in the Courts with the Hon. Magistrate Chi Soo Kim.  Breakout sessions include: Civil:  Morning session TBA, and 10 Rules on Contractual; Attorney Fees presented by Mark Ellis; cross-over family and probate/estate planning, Until Death Do Us Part (Robin Klomparens) and a round-table discussion with Kenny Pierce;  Probate and Estate Planning will also have Jim Flippi discussing caselaw updates.  The Hon. Richard Couzens will present his criminal law updates and Presiding Judge and Assistant Presiding Judges Penney and Gazzaniga, respectively, will be discussing criminal trials.

MCLE credit hours are a total of 11 hours.  Of those hours, we are offering 2.0 hours in Ethics, 1.0 in Implicit Bias, 1.0 hours credit in competency/mindfulness, and 1.0 hours credit in technology.  All of the estate planning sessions will qualify for specialty credit.
